Grandma's Vodka Sauce

Indulge in the comforting, rich flavors of Grandma's Vodka Sauce, a timeless family recipe that transforms simple ingredients into a creamy, robust masterpiece. This versatile sauce starts with the perfect base of sautéed onions, garlic, and a touch of red pepper flakes for gentle heat, then builds depth with caramelized tomato paste and a splash of vodka to deglaze the pan. Fold in heavenly heavy cream, freshly grated Parmesan cheese, and aromatic basil for an irresistibly silky finish. Perfectly balanced with optional hints of sugar to temper acidity, this 30-minute recipe is ideal for busy weeknights yet sophisticated enough for special occasions. Whether draped over penne or fettuccine, this luxurious vodka sauce will have everyone coming back for seconds.

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:30 mins
Total Time:40 mins
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ons Unsalted butter
  • 1 medium Yellow onion, finely diced
  • 3 cloves Garlic cloves, minced
  • 0.5 teaspoons Red pepper flakes
  • 6 ounces Tomato paste
  • 0.5 cups Vodka
  • 1 cups Heavy cream
  • 0.5 cups Gr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h basil leaves, chopped
  • 1 teaspoons Kosher sal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ons Ground black pepper
  • 1 teaspoons Sugar (optional, for balancing acidity)

Directions

Step 1

Heat the olive oil and butter in a large sauté pan over medium heat until the butter is melted and just beginning to foam.

Step 2

Add the diced onion to the pan and cook, stirring occasionally, until translucent and softened, about 5 minutes.

Step 3

Add the minced garlic and red pepper flakes, and sauté for an additional 1-2 minutes until fragrant.

Step 4

Stir in the tomato paste and cook, stirring frequently, for about 5 minutes or until the paste darkens in color and caramelizes slightly.

Step 5

Carefully pour in the vodka, scraping the bottom of the pan to deglaze it. Simmer for 2-3 minutes to allow the alcohol to burn off.

Step 6

Lower the heat to medium-low, and slowly stir in the heavy cream. Allow the sauce to simmer gently for 8-10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until slightly thickened.

Step 7

Add the grated Parmesan cheese, salt, and pepper. Stir until the cheese is fully melted and incorporated into the sauce.

Step 8

Taste the sauce and add the optional sugar if needed to balance the acidity of the tomatoes.

Step 9

Mix in the fresh basil at the end, reserving a bit for garnish if desired.

Step 10

Serve immediately over your favorite pasta (such as penne or fettuccine), and garnish with additional Parmesan cheese and basil if desired.
